The hotel’s history is entwined with the land, and thanks to the owner’s decades of observation work, the surroundings are rife with wildlife. On safari, you’ll be treated to sightings of peacocks, cranes, turtles, even dolphins and crocodiles.
Alternatively, cycle along the highway, hike through the village of Rapri, or take a camel ride to Fort Ater. Whether you’re looking for adventure or relaxation, Chambal Safari Lodge has plenty for you to enjoy.

- A wildlife lover’s paradise–a plethora of unique species inhabit Chambal Valley, from turtles to marsh crocodiles, river dolphins to otters
- The property is entirely carbon neutral, running on 100% solar power
- Close to a number of historically important sites, for those that want to mix culture with nature
- Plenty of activities available while not on safari, from heritage hikes to cycle tours
While there is no pool on site, yoga classes and badminton courts can still keep you active
Being surrounded by wildlife, you may hear plenty of noises during the night. But we much prefer these to the roaring sounds of the city
There’s little choice for high quality restaurants nearby, but the hotel offers huge buffets with plenty of variety
